Community Home offered by Beacon Youth Shelter

415 South 13th Street, Tacoma, WA 98402

Eligibility
Young adults (18-24) who are experiencing homelessness. (Services can be utilized until age 25 is reached).
Hours
Shelter is provided 24 hours daily. Participants must be to be onsite by 10pm to secure a bed
Application process
Drop-in. Door is on Fawcett Ave.
Fees
None.
Service area
Pierce, WA

Offers a 24 hour, low barrier shelter for youth/young adults experiencing homelessness between the ages of 18-24 (services can be utilized until age 25 is reached) The Day Center is open daily from 8am-4pm. Night Shelter provided from 4pm-8am daily. Program serves all genders. Breakfast, Lunch and Dinner served daily Laundry services, and showers available for use for Day Center and Night Program Case Management on site Daily programming focusing on life skills - Educational and workforce training opportunities available weekly.
